Companies ask employees from Mangor Hill to work from home

Team Herald

panjim: On Monday evening, many companies have asked their staff members who are living in Vasco’s Mangor Hill area, to work from home. Mangor Hill, which had surfaced with positive Covid19 cases, has been declared as containment zone, the first in Goa, since the outbreak of virus in the country.

Goa Shipyard Ltd’s (GSL) Public Relation Officer, Nikhil Wagh told Herald that, “Last evening we have issued an advisory for people staying in Mangor Hill area to work from home till further orders and we have also requested them to follow all government norms and instructions.” There are around 25 people who are staying in Mangor Hill and are working for GSL.

Mormugao Port Trust (MPT)’s spokesperson said that there are not too many people working for MPT who are staying in Mangor Hill but they have conveyed to the few who are staying there to continue to work from home. 

 “In fact if they are in containment zone, then they will naturally be not allowed to move out,” said the spokesperson.

Goa State Industries Association (GSIA) President, Damodar Kochkar said that there were queries before him and he has advised them to follow the instructions given by the government. “Being in containment zone, people will not be allowed to move anyways. Whatever guidelines which have been laid by the government authorities, we need to follow them very stringently and there should not be any relaxation on that.

Verna Industries Association President, Pradip Da Costa said that not many people working in the Verna Industrial Estate (VIE), stay in Mangor Hill and hence it is not affected much. “Many of the workers from VIE stay near Verna and we are not much affected,” said the new VIA President.
